Team
The team is actually 16 people and I'm (Sully) loathe to expand it. It's most of the CoC (Community oversight committee), a lot of OSM, a few from CLT, a few from the Forum global mods and that's it.
Rules
- No politics or governance at all.
- One post per weekday except in unusual circumstances.
- Priority goes to Joomlla! releases--if there's a security or new version release, we post that and only that for 24 hours.
- Do not "Like" our own posts.
the challenge with FB is that we need to moderate discussion, encourage newbies and take out the spam
